About General Kinematics

General Kinematics specializes in the custom design of vibratory equipment for bulk-material processing. The company develops purpose-built systems based on each customer’s throughput requirements, available installation space, and operating temperatures.

In addition to stand-alone equipment, General Kinematics supplies integrated systems designed to automate and optimize processes such as drying and sorting.

General Kinematics Vibratory Fluid Bed Dryers

General Kinematics Vibratory Fluid Bed Dryer
Source: General Kinematics Official Website
https://www.generalkinematics.com/product/fluid-bed-dryers/

The Vibratory Fluid Bed Dryer is designed specifically for drying applications. It combines process-gas flow with mechanical vibration to fluidize the material and increase the surface area exposed to the air. This promotes consistent contact between the material, heat, and process gas to support efficient drying throughout the material bed.

The system supports both continuous and batch processing, including low-temperature drying applications. It can be configured for specific operating requirements, with options such as upgraded construction materials and adjustable fluid bed depths.

General Kinematics Vibrating Fluid Bed Processors

General Kinematics Vibrating Fluid Bed Processor
Source: General Kinematics Official Website
https://www.generalkinematics.com/product/vibrating-fluid-bed-processors/

The multipurpose Vibrating Fluid Bed Processor supports a range of continuous processes, including drying, heating, cooling, and coating.

The system uses process gas and vibration to suspend and agitate the material, increasing the surface area available for contact with heat and process gas. This design supports consistent processing throughout the material bed.

Adjustable stroke, angle of throw, and fluid bed depth allow the unit to be configured for specific throughput requirements.

General Kinematics ASR Drying Solutions

General Kinematics ASR Drying Solutions
Source: General Kinematics Official Website
https://www.generalkinematics.com/product/asr-drying-solutions/

ASR Drying Solutions are vibratory fluid bed systems designed specifically for drying Automotive Shredder Residue (ASR) and ASR fines. The systems combine vibration with process gas to remove moisture from the material, which can support improved metal recovery from ASR fines.

Each system can be configured for specific processing capacities and installation constraints. The equipment can also be adapted for cooling and heating applications.

Product Case Studies

General Kinematics has published a case study covering an installation for a tobacco-leaf drying process.

Case Study: Tobacco Drying

A customer wanted to improve tobacco-leaf quality and automate an existing process but could not make major facility modifications because of space constraints. General Kinematics designed and supplied a 600-square-foot fluid bed processing system to fit the available footprint.

According to the company’s case study, the installation increased plant capacity and resulted in a 66% reduction in overhead costs.
